Ancient acetylene / carbide lamp JOS. LUCAS « Silvia Major » No. 255 – Birmingham
Rare antique lamp from the brand Jos. Lucas, a famous British maker of lighting equipment for bicycles, automobiles and vintage vehicles.
Characteristics:
Original markings:
"JOS. LUCAS BIRMINGHAM"
"SILVIA MAJOR N°255"
Manufactured in nickel-plated metal.
Original reflector in good condition.
Adjustment mechanism and reservoir present.
Beautiful patina from the period.
Not restored, kept in its natural state.
Description:
This Silvia Major lamp No. 255 dates from the early 20th century. It was used as an acetylene (carbide) lamp on bicycles, motorcycles or vintage vehicles. Lucas lamps are today highly sought after by collectors of British vintage accessories and enthusiasts of old vehicles.
